web前端全栈学习哪些知识

fiy 其他 47

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习web前端全栈知识需要掌握的知识包括以下几个方面:

    1. HTML和CSS:作为前端开发的基础,掌握HTML和CSS的技能是必不可少的。HTML负责页面的结构,CSS负责页面的样式设计。

    2. JavaScript:JavaScript是前端开发中最重要的编程语言之一。要熟练掌握JavaScript的语法和基本概念,包括变量、函数、对象等。同时要学习DOM操作,掌握基本的事件处理和动态页面操作。

    3. 前端框架:掌握常见的前端框架,如React、Angular或Vue。这些框架可以加快开发速度,提高代码复用性,并提供了更好的用户体验。

    4. 后端技术:学习后端技术可以让你更全面地理解整个web应用的架构。了解后端语言,如Java、Python或Node.js,并学习数据库操作和服务器端的编程。

    5. 数据库:学习SQL语言和关系型数据库的基本操作,如MySQL或Oracle。同时也要了解NoSQL数据库的使用,如MongoDB等。

    6. 版本控制工具:学习使用Git等版本控制工具,可以更好地管理代码,协作开发,以及进行代码回滚等操作。

    7. 掌握调试工具:如Chrome开发者工具,可以帮助你快速定位和调试前端代码中的错误,提高开发效率。

    8. 其他技能:学习前端性能优化,了解移动端开发和响应式设计,熟悉前端安全等知识,可以使你的应用更加高效、稳定和安全。

    总之,学习web前端全栈知识需要掌握HTML、CSS、JavaScript等基础技术,同时学习前端框架、后端技术、数据库等相关知识,以及一些辅助工具和其他技能。不断学习和实践,不断提升自己的技术水平,才能成为一名优秀的web前端全栈工程师。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习Web前端全栈开发需要掌握一系列知识和技能,包括但不限于以下方面:

    1. HTML和CSS:HTML是网页结构的标记语言,CSS用于描述网页的样式和布局。掌握HTML和CSS可以搭建网页的基本结构和外观。

    2. JavaScript:作为前端开发的核心语言,掌握JavaScript能够实现网页的交互效果和动态功能。学习JavaScript需要掌握DOM操作、事件处理、Ajax等技术。

    3.前端框架与库:学习一些流行的前端框架和库,如React、Angular、Vue等,可以提高开发效率和代码质量。掌握它们的使用方法,并熟悉相关的生态系统和工具链。

    1. 前端工具:了解和掌握一些前端工具,如Git版本控制,Webpack打包工具,Grunt和Gulp等自动化任务工具,能够提高开发效率和代码的可维护性。

    2. 后端技术:作为全栈开发者,了解后端的基本知识是必要的,可以选择学习一些后端开发语言和框架,如Node.js、Django、Ruby on Rails等。熟悉后端开发可以帮助理解整个Web应用的架构和流程。

    3. 数据库:了解和学习一些数据库知识,如MySQL、MongoDB等,能够与后端进行数据交互和数据处理操作。

    4. 接口和网络协议:了解HTTP协议、RESTful接口和数据传输格式,能够与后端进行数据交互和对接API接口。

    5. 用户体验和设计:了解一些用户体验设计的基本原则和方法,对网页的用户界面和交互进行优化,提升用户体验。

    6. 安全性:了解常见的Web安全漏洞和攻击方式,学习一些安全防范措施和技术,保护网站的安全。

    7. 部署和服务器管理:学习一些基本的服务器管理知识,能够搭建和配置服务器环境,部署和发布项目。

    学习Web前端全栈开发需要不断的学习和实践,掌握上述知识可以帮助你成为一个全面的前端开发者。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习全栈开发意味着要掌握前端和后端开发的技术和知识,以下是学习web前端全栈所需的一些重要知识:

    1. HTML/CSS:学习HTML/CSS是入门前端开发的基础。HTML用于定义网页的结构和内容,CSS用于控制网页的样式和布局。

    2. JavaScript:JavaScript是一种用于构建交互式网页的编程语言。学习JavaScript可以实现网页的动态效果和交互功能。

    3. 前端框架:掌握流行的前端框架可以提高开发效率和代码质量。常见的前端框架有Angular、React和Vue.js。

    4. 前端工具:掌握各种前端工具可以提高开发效率。例如Webpack用于打包和优化前端资源,Grunt和Gulp用于自动化任务。

    5. 前端调试和优化:了解前端调试技术,可以提高开发效率和代码质量。学习如何使用浏览器的开发者工具和调试工具,以及如何优化网页性能。

    6. 后端开发语言:学习一种后端开发语言,例如Python、Java 或者 PHP。后端开发语言用于处理服务器端的业务逻辑和与数据库交互。

    7. 数据库:学习关系型数据库(例如MySQL)和非关系型数据库(例如MongoDB)。掌握数据库设计和查询语言可以存储和处理数据。

    8. 后端框架:掌握流行的后端框架可以快速开发服务器端应用。例如Python的Django、Java的Spring和PHP的Laravel等。

    9. Web服务:了解Web服务的原理和常用技术。学习如何使用HTTP协议、RESTful API和Websocket等来处理网络请求和数据传输。

    10. 版本控制:掌握版本控制工具,例如Git。版本控制可以追踪代码的变化,方便团队协作和代码管理。

    11. 安全性和性能优化:学习如何保护网站的安全和提高性能。了解常见的Web安全漏洞和性能优化技巧,以提供更好的用户体验。

    12. 项目管理和团队协作:学习如何进行项目管理和团队协作。了解敏捷开发方法和团队协作工具,可以提高开发效率和团队合作能力。

    总之,学习web前端全栈需要掌握HTML/CSS、JavaScript、前端框架、前端工具、后端开发语言、数据库、后端框架、Web服务、版本控制、安全性和性能优化、项目管理和团队协作等多个方面的知识。通过系统学习和实践,逐步掌握这些知识,就能成为一名全栈开发工程师。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部